How to get to Siem Reap

314km northwest of Phnom Penh, along Naitonal Roa No. 6. It can be reached all year round by National Ro No. 6 from Phnom Penh Capital, Poi Pet Border Check-point, Banteay Meanchey Province, and by National Road No. 5 from Kampong Chnang, Pursat and Bat-tambana Province. Siem Reap Province is accessible by both international and domestic arrival from many major cities in the region with probably around 6,615 movements to Siem Reap since Jan 2012 — June 2012. It can also be reached on domestic flights from Phnom Penh by Cambodian Angkor Air and many different types of aircrafts. Siem Reap Province can also be reached by boats along the Tonle Sap River and its lake from Phnom Penh capital and Battambang Province.

Bus
One can reach city by bus from Phnom Penh city by national road # 6, Banteay Meanchey Province by National Road # 5. Also as there are regularly scheduled air-con buses operate between Siem Reap and Poipet, a border city of Thai-land and from Ho Chi Minh City (Vietnam).
